Description

Direct-to-Substrate Engineering
PREMFLEX is engineered with a high-performance, single-pack acrylic resin system designed to eliminate the priming stage entirely. This self-priming formulation bonds aggressively to plywood, OSB, metal, and concrete, significantly reducing labor time and material costs. By removing the need for an undercoat, it allows contractors to secure and decorate site perimeters with maximum speed and efficiency.

Perimeter Weatherproofing
Construction sites are exposed environments; PREMFLEX is built to withstand them. The coating cures to a 50-micron thick film that remains flexible enough to handle the movement of temporary boarding while resisting rain and UV exposure. The durable satin finish not only provides a professional aesthetic for site branding but also creates a washable surface that stands up to the dust and grime of active building zones.

Rapid Deployment
Time is money on a job site. This coating is formulated for fast turnaround, becoming touch-dry and ready for overcoating in just 2-4 hours. Its water-based composition ensures low odour and safe application in public-facing areas, while allowing for easy soap-and-water cleanup of sprayers and rollers. It is the definitive solution for large-scale hoarding projects requiring immediate protection.
